Critiques:
All good artists stop and take some time to reflect on what they have done or created when an artwork is completed. I call this assessing or critiquing our art. So with a lot of our assignments we will do just that-take a look at what we created and reflect on the strengths and weaknesses. So as a guide I want you to answer the following questions about what you have created within your collage.
Click on comment on the bottom of today’s date and post a comment. I would sign in first at the upper right hand side and then come back to this page and post your answers in the comments section. Bookmark the blog page as you will need this page a lot throughout this year.
Question 1: Take a look at your artwork. I want you to list at least 2 strengths about your artwork. For example: You can talk about the photo’s you took if you feel that those turned out really well. Or, if you really like what you created with the collage layout you can talk about that. Use at least 3 art terms when talking about your artwork.
Question 2: Now view your artwork in a different way. If you were walking by your artwork as a viewer how would you view your artwork. Is it interesting to look at, does it grab your attention? If so what parts are interesting or grab your attention? Describe in detail the way your feel about your final piece from an outside perspective.
